↓ 9.58pp vs 2011Year-over-Year Comparison
| Indicator | 2011 | 2012 | Change |
|---|---|---|---|
| GDP (Current USD) | $172.60 billion | $195.59 billion | +13.32% |
| GDP per Capita | $1,950.93 | $2,185.12 | +12.00% |
| GDP Growth (Annual %) | 6.41% | 5.50% | -0.91pp |
| Inflation (CPI %) | 18.68% | 9.09% | -9.58pp |
| Unemployment Rate (%) | 1.00% | 1.03% | +0.03pp |

Frequently Asked Questions
As of 2012, Viet Nam's Gross Domestic Product (GDP) is $195.59 billion. This represents the total value of goods and services produced in the country.
The GDP per capita in Viet Nam for 2012 is $2,185.12. GDP per capita is calculated by dividing the country's GDP by its population.
The Consumer Price Index (CPI) inflation rate in Viet Nam for 2012 is 9.09%. This measures the annual percentage change in the cost of consumer goods and services.
Viet Nam's annual GDP growth rate for 2012 is 5.50%. This indicates the rate at which the country's economy is expanding or contracting.
The unemployment rate in Viet Nam for 2012 is 1.03%. This represents the percentage of the labor force that is unemployed and actively seeking employment.
